This bull cycle accidentally created some of the most brilliant marketing plays we've ever seen. Look at how these products got rebranded:
Onchain trading? Basically a poker table. You're playing with real money, real odds, zero emotional guardrails.
Prediction markets? That's just sports betting with a decentralized wrapper. Same dopamine hit, different venue.
Perp DEXes are essentially what 0DTE stock options used to be—or just straight-up slot machines for anyone without proper risk management. The house always wins eventually.
Then there's RWA. Real World Assets. The most abstract term nobody could actually explain. A solution searching for a problem, dressed up in buzzwords?
The cycle didn't create innovation so much as it created a masterclass in repackaging existing financial behaviors with crypto branding. Same games, shinier interface.
